NYCEDCs Development Department spearheads NYCEDC and interagency efforts on complex planning and development projects which advance the Citys competitiveness, enhancing New York City as a place to live, work and visit through promoting a diverse economic base; fostering vibrant, livable and accessible neighborhoods; executing keystone economic development projects; leveraging diverse waterfront assets for economic, recreational and resiliency uses; and supporting and expanding the Citys freight, maritime, aviation and transportation networks. Specifically, Development works to identify strategic locations for public involvement and/or investment; develop and facilitate appropriate planning and community outreach processes; and shape land use and development. Examples of Developments role in key City initiatives can be seen in neighborhoods throughout the five boroughs, including in neighborhood planning efforts such as Inwood, Manhattan and Downtown Far Rockaway, Queens, and through our engagement with large-scale planning efforts including the Sunnyside Yards Overbuild Feasibility Study, the Lower Manhattan Coastal Resiliency project, and the Downtown Staten Island initiative. The Development Department works closely with staff at various City agencies in support of high-profile Administration rezoning and redevelopment efforts, and provides strategic guidance to other divisions within NYCEDC in relation to community engagement, neighborhood planning, public-private partnerships, and major infrastructure investments. About NYCEDC: The New York City Economic Development Corporation (NYCEDC) is a non-profit organization that reports to the Deputy Mayor for Economic Development and Rebuilding. The NYCEDC is charged with encouraging economic growth in New York City through a variety of means, including facilitating real estate development, improving infrastructure, attracting and retaining businesses, and conducting economic research and analysis.
